🧠Methodology

We estimate the maximum FPS the processor can sustain and the maximum FPS the graphics card can sustain in each setting, then compare those limits directly.

Limit Factor formula: (stronger - weaker) / stronger. Example: if CPU ceiling is 200 FPS and GPU ceiling is 140 FPS, then GPU limits CPU by 30%.

CPU Limits GPU means the processor ceiling is lower. GPU Limits CPU means the graphics ceiling is lower. Balanced means the FPS ceilings are close enough that the gap is negligible.

A component can still be the FPS limiter without reaching 100% utilization. The displayed percentages are derived from FPS ceilings, not generic utilization heuristics.

Minimum Requirements
Video Card: GeForce GTX 660
Processor: Core i5-2500K
Memory: 8 GB
Disk Space: 20 GB
System: Windows 10 64-bit
Recommended Requirements
Video Card: GeForce GTX 1060
Processor: Core i7-6700K
Memory: 16 GB
Disk Space: 20 GB (SSD)
System: Windows 10 64-bit
